Abstract:

The influences of central wavelength of the seed pulse and gain fiber length of the amplifier on the characteristics of broad band spectra arc systematically investigated based on nonlinear ytterbium-doped fiber amplifiers. The dissipative solitons from the nonlinear amplifier arc obtained by using the nonlinear polarization rotation mode-locking technique. The best flat wide spectrum with wavelength range of 1010-1600 nm is obtained when the center wavelength of the seed pulse is 1011 nm and the gain fiber length of the amplifier is 8 m. The flatness is about 10 dB, and the wide spectral flatness is less than 1.5 dB from 1010 to 1250 nm.
